At European Level

NYCI engages at a European level with the European Youth Forum, which also promotes global education. With the launch of the new European Youth Strategy at the end of 2009, NYCI hosted a seminar 'Engaging with Youth and the World - from Policy to Practice' which looked at 'Youth and the World' as a field of action of the European Youth Strategy.

As a member of Dóchas, and the Dóchas Development Education Group (DEG), NYCI's Development Education Project Officer Elaine Mahon represents Dóchas as the Irish platform of CONCORD and their Development Awareness-Raising and Education (DARE) forum.

North-South centre of the Council of Europe - Global Education week

Global Education Week...

One World Week is part of a Europe-wide network of global "focus weeks" under the banner of the Global Education Week, which is coordinated by the North-South Centre of the Council of Europe.
